Transaction 74cf32dab5d8121855623650f6ab638e28ccbc14b5c8127f005f720c15c1ed66
1 Input
1 Output
-
74cf32dab5d8121855623650f6ab638e28ccbc14b5c8127f005f720c15c1ed66:0
- value
- 60348837
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e19e9ee66cd90a319a830d3da2a168f063e4fbe
- address
- bc1qpcv7nmnxekg2xxdgxrfa52sk3urruna7hsf56r